Handbook of Topical Drug Treatment in Dermatology

摘要

This book is the first authoritative volume dedicated to topical medication treatments in dermatology. This book provides an up-to-date synopsis of the clinical applications and uses of topical drugs in dermatological diseases. It provides to the reader – at their fingertips - the recommended dermatologic uses for topical drugs. It correlates dermatologic conditions with topical drug treatments listed alphabetically.  In addition, this volume discusses the clinical implications, special patient populations, drug pharmacokinetics, adverse effects and precautions, and will make comparisons to other therapeutic alternatives to treat a dermatologic condition, as appropriate.

 Handbook of Topical Drug Treatment in Dermatology is an essential resource for physicians, pharmacists, fellows, residents in dermatology and general medical practice, as well as students in medicine, pharmacy and other health care professions. It serves as a companion handbook to the Handbook of Systemic Drug Treatment in Dermatology, currently in its 3rd edition.
